TITLE: Program Manager
LOCATION: Mountain View, CA (on-site Tuesday – Thursday)
ANTICIPATED DURATION: Until the end of 2025


As a Program Manager, you execute defined programs for your immediate team with collaboration from your teammates. You execute well-defined projects under limited guidance. You stretch to address undefined challenges with limited guidance from your teammates. You utilize existing protocols including meetings and project plans to monitor and manage program tasks and stakeholders. You identify, collaborate with, and communicate to stakeholders with minimal guidance from your teammates. You have foundational knowledge of the domain of your program.

Program Manager Responsibilities:
  • In close collaboration with program stakeholders, author program charter that addresses scope,timeline, OKRs, resourcing and risks/dependencies of a basic program. Create project plans that break down a project into discrete phases and include risks/dependencies.
  • Collect data relating to program progress from program stakeholders. Maintain project trackers and status reports in close collaboration with program stakeholders. Identify and execute on program tasks, incorporating Product Excellence values, Product Inclusion, and brand trust and reputation. Collect Data to inform mitigations, postmortems, and escalation reports. Facilitate effective meetings.
  • Create and deliver program communications in close collaboration with program stakeholders. Ensure communications are organized and visible to immediate program stakeholders.
  • Document program team roles and responsibilities across projects. In close collaboration with program stakeholders, author stakeholder map. Identify stakeholder misalignment and coordinate resolution.
